Cardiovascular Conditions

Surgical correction plays a critical role in treating various cardiovascular conditions. Aortic aneurysms, for instance, pose a significant risk of rupture if left untreated. Surgical repair is often the only viable option to prevent catastrophic events. Valvular heart disease, characterized by compromised heart valve function, can lead to heart failure if not addressed surgically. Specific procedures, such as valve replacement, are crucial for maintaining healthy cardiac function.

Neurological Conditions

Surgical intervention in neurological conditions addresses a range of issues. Conditions like spinal stenosis, characterized by narrowing of the spinal canal, can compress nerves and cause significant pain and neurological deficits. Surgical decompression relieves pressure on the nerves, mitigating symptoms and improving function. Brain tumors, if large enough or located in critical areas, require surgical removal to prevent further damage and associated complications.

Condition Symptoms Underlying Cause Surgical Intervention
Scoliosis Curvature of the spine, uneven shoulders, back pain Genetic predisposition, muscular imbalances, or developmental abnormalities Spinal fusion, bracing
Aortic Aneurysm Severe abdominal or back pain, pulsating sensation Weakening of the aortic wall, often due to atherosclerosis Surgical repair, stent placement
Spinal Stenosis Back pain, numbness, tingling in the limbs, weakness Narrowing of the spinal canal, often related to age-related changes or injury Decompression surgery
Brain Tumor Headache, seizures, neurological deficits Abnormal growth of cells in the brain Tumor resection, radiation therapy
Hernia Bulge or lump in the affected area, pain, discomfort Weakening of the abdominal wall muscles, allowing organs to protrude Surgical repair, hernia mesh

Severity and Progression of the Condition

The severity of the condition and its progression play a critical role in determining the need for surgical correction. Conditions with a rapidly deteriorating state or those causing significant impairment may necessitate surgical intervention sooner rather than later. For instance, a severe spinal stenosis causing significant neurological deficits might require immediate surgical decompression, whereas a less severe case might be managed initially with physical therapy and medication. Conversely, conditions that are stable and minimally impacting daily function may not require immediate surgical intervention.

Effectiveness of Non-Surgical Treatments

Exploring and exhausting non-surgical treatment options is vital before considering surgery. These may include medication, physical therapy, lifestyle modifications, or other conservative approaches. For example, osteoarthritis of the knee can sometimes be effectively managed with pain relievers, physical therapy focusing on strengthening and range of motion exercises, and weight loss. If these non-surgical methods fail to provide adequate relief or if the condition continues to worsen, surgical intervention may become a necessary option.

Patient’s Overall Health and Medical History

A patient’s overall health and medical history significantly influence the suitability of surgical correction. Pre-existing conditions, such as cardiovascular disease or diabetes, can increase the risks associated with surgery. The patient’s age, activity level, and general health status are also critical considerations. For instance, a patient with severe heart disease might not be a suitable candidate for major surgical procedures, whereas a younger, healthier individual with a similar condition might be. Potential Complications Table

Potential Complications Likelihood Prevention Methods
Infection Moderate Strict adherence to sterile technique, antibiotic prophylaxis, meticulous wound care
Bleeding Low to Moderate Careful surgical technique, blood transfusions as needed, close monitoring
Nerve damage Low Precise surgical technique, meticulous dissection, monitoring for neurological deficits
Blood clots Low to Moderate Early mobilization, compression stockings, anticoagulant therapy
Adverse reactions to anesthesia Low Pre-operative evaluation, appropriate anesthetic selection, monitoring during and after surgery
